We checked into this resort for a six-day stay, and just loved it, for many reasons. It was in a beautiful setting, we had a bungalow metres from the beach, the snorkelling was good, and the staff were mostly very helpful.
However, a couple of downsides. The wifi was very poor - often couldn't log on at all. And the food. While the a la carte dining in the evening was excellent, the breakfast spread was not. Cold "hot" food - every morning - and the fresh fruit and yoghurt were rationed to the point of our having to ask for it from the staff. Ditto spoons with which to eat the yoghurt - every morning! No sign of non-sugary cereals, no wholemeal or grain bread - just a ton of white bread and pastries.
We also would have appreciated more information about La Piscine Naturelle, which we visited in the resort's minibus. No information about the entry fee (we almost didn't take any money with us), how to get in there, or the fact that there were no toilets or facilities. Having said that, it was stunningly beautiful.
